|
Are any of the other fields Zoned too? Just an idea, first, why use zoned anyway, but how about changing it to 9P2 instead. Perhaps the expected result is going to be longer than the 8-digit zoned field? -Bob Cozzi www.RPGxTools.com If everything is under control, you are going too slow. - Mario Andretti -----Original Message----- From: rpg400-l-bounces@xxxxxxxxxxxx [mailto:rpg400-l-bounces@xxxxxxxxxxxx] On Behalf Of Douglas W. Palme Sent: Thursday, July 14, 2005 11:18 AM To: RPG Group Subject: ready to pull my hair out final SQL question of the day after this I am going to go home, throw the phone out the back door, fill the ice bucket with ice, grab a tumbler and a bottle of single malt and park my carcus on the sofa and not move for the rest of the day...... I started expanding my select statement, which includes a calculated field : sum(ilneprice) - sum(ilneuavcst) as margin I have declared a variable dmargin as a type S length of 8 with two decimals.....so far so good.... In my fetch statement I have the following: C/EXEC SQL C+ FETCH DETAILCURSOR C+ INTO :ALPHA, :CUSTNO, :DNAME, :STKNO, :DESC, :PRICE, :COST, :DMARGIN C/END-EXEC When I go to compile the sql precompiler balks and tells me that the variable DMARGIN is not defined or usable.....nothing else. Its declared properly and everything else seems to work. I checked the order of the select fields and that is ok as well. I would post the relevant code but I did not want the message to be too long. Ideas? If you bought, it was hauled by a truck - somewhere, sometime.
As an Amazon Associate we earn from qualifying purchases.
This mailing list archive is Copyright 1997-2024 by midrange.com and David Gibbs as a compilation work. Use of the archive is restricted to research of a business or technical nature. Any other uses are prohibited. Full details are available on our policy page. If you have questions about this, please contact [javascript protected email address].
Operating expenses for this site are earned using the Amazon Associate program and Google Adsense.